📌 Key Takeaways
- The 2026 Winter Olympics officially began with a grand opening ceremony at the San Siro Stadium in Milan.
- The event featured the traditional Parade of Nations, showcasing athletes from more than 90 different countries.
- Organizers emphasized a blend of Italian cultural heritage and modern sustainability themes throughout the performance.
- The lighting of the Olympic cauldron signaled the start of 16 days of competition across Milan and Cortina d'Ampezzo.

San Siro
Stadium in Milan, Italy
San Siro is a football stadium in the San Siro district of Milan, Italy. Nicknamed La Scala del calcio (English: La Scala of Football), it has a seating capacity of 75,817, making it the largest stadium in Italy and one of the largest stadiums in Europe.
